diff -r eae5d6623fd3 -r af087d0fad9b ui/winui/image.h --- a/ui/winui/image.h Wed Oct 30 12:23:52 2024 +0100 +++ b/ui/winui/image.h Wed Oct 30 15:15:36 2024 +0100 @@ -31,3 +31,13 @@ #include "../ui/toolkit.h" #include "../ui/image.h" +class UiImageSource { +public: + winrt::Microsoft::UI::Xaml::Media::ImageSource imgsrc { nullptr }; + + UiImageSource(winrt::Microsoft::UI::Xaml::Media::ImageSource& src); +}; + + +extern "C" void* ui_image_get(UiGeneric *g); +extern "C" int ui_image_set(UiGeneric *g, void *data, const char *type);